// UN CLI - C Implementation (using curl subprocess for simplicity)
// Compile: gcc -o un_c un_inception.c
// Usage:
// un_c script.py
// un_c -e KEY=VALUE -f data.txt script.py
// un_c session --list
// un_c service --name web --ports 8080
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#define API_BASE "https://api.unsandbox.com"
#define BLUE "\033[34m"
#define RED "\033[31m"
#define GREEN "\033[32m"
#define YELLOW "\033[33m"
#define RESET "\033[0m"
const char* detect_language(const char *filename) {
const char *ext = strrchr(filename, '.');
if (!ext) return NULL;
if (strcmp(ext, ".py") == 0) return "python";
if (strcmp(ext, ".js") == 0) return "javascript";
if (strcmp(ext, ".ts") == 0) return "typescript";
if (strcmp(ext, ".go") == 0) return "go";
if (strcmp(ext, ".rs") == 0) return "rust";
if (strcmp(ext, ".c") == 0) return "c";
if (strcmp(ext, ".cpp") == 0 || strcmp(ext, ".cc") == 0) return "cpp";
if (strcmp(ext, ".d") == 0) return "d";
if (strcmp(ext, ".zig") == 0) return "zig";
if (strcmp(ext, ".nim") == 0) return "nim";
if (strcmp(ext, ".v") == 0) return "v";
if (strcmp(ext, ".rb") == 0) return "ruby";
if (strcmp(ext, ".php") == 0) return "php";
if (strcmp(ext, ".pl") == 0) return "perl";
if (strcmp(ext, ".lua") == 0) return "lua";
if (strcmp(ext, ".sh") == 0) return "bash";
return NULL;
}
char* read_file(const char *filename) {
FILE *f = fopen(filename, "rb");
if (!f) return NULL;
fseek(f, 0, SEEK_END);
long fsize = ftell(f);
fseek(f, 0, SEEK_SET);
char *content = malloc(fsize + 1);
if (!content) {
fclose(f);
return NULL;
}
fread(content, 1, fsize, f);
content[fsize] = 0;
fclose(f);
return content;
}
void escape_json_char(FILE *out, char c) {
switch (c) {
case '"': fputs("\\\"", out); break;
case '\\': fputs("\\\\", out); break;
case '\n': fputs("\\n", out); break;
case '\r': fputs("\\r", out); break;
case '\t': fputs("\\t", out); break;
default: fputc(c, out); break;
}
}
void cmd_execute(const char *source_file, char **envs, int env_count, char **files, int file_count, int artifacts, const char *output_dir, const char *network, int vcpu, const char *api_key) {
const char *language = detect_language(source_file);
if (!language) {
fprintf(stderr, "%sError: Cannot detect language%s\n", RED, RESET);
exit(1);
}
char *code = read_file(source_file);
if (!code) {
fprintf(stderr, "%sError reading file%s\n", RED, RESET);
exit(1);
}
// Build JSON request body
FILE *jsonf = tmpfile();
fprintf(jsonf, "{\"language\":\"%s\",\"code\":\"", language);
for (const char *p = code; *p; p++) {
escape_json_char(jsonf, *p);
}
fprintf(jsonf, "\"");
// Add env vars
if (env_count > 0) {
fprintf(jsonf, ",\"env\":{");
for (int i = 0; i < env_count; i++) {
char *eq = strchr(envs[i], '=');
if (eq) {
if (i > 0) fprintf(jsonf, ",");
fprintf(jsonf, "\"");
for (char *p = envs[i]; p < eq; p++) fputc(*p, jsonf);
fprintf(jsonf, "\":\"");
for (char *p = eq + 1; *p; p++) {
escape_json_char(jsonf, *p);
}
fprintf(jsonf, "\"");
}
}
fprintf(jsonf, "}");
}
// Note: Input files would require base64 encoding - skipped for simplicity
if (artifacts) {
fprintf(jsonf, ",\"return_artifacts\":true");
}
if (network) {
fprintf(jsonf, ",\"network\":\"%s\"", network);
}
if (vcpu > 0) {
fprintf(jsonf, ",\"vcpu\":%d", vcpu);
}
fprintf(jsonf, "}");
fflush(jsonf);
rewind(jsonf);
// Read JSON to string
fseek(jsonf, 0, SEEK_END);
long json_size = ftell(jsonf);
rewind(jsonf);
char *json_body = malloc(json_size + 1);
fread(json_body, 1, json_size, jsonf);
json_body[json_size] = 0;
fclose(jsonf);
// Make API request using curl
char cmd[8192];
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X POST '%s/execute' "
"-H 'Content-Type: application/json' "
"-H 'Authorization: Bearer %s' "
"-d @- << 'EOF'\n%s\nEOF",
API_BASE, api_key, json_body);
FILE *curl = popen(cmd, "r");
if (!curl) {
fprintf(stderr, "%sError running curl%s\n", RED, RESET);
exit(1);
}
// Read response
char response[1048576];
size_t resp_len = fread(response, 1, sizeof(response) - 1, curl);
response[resp_len] = 0;
pclose(curl);
// Parse simple JSON (stdout, stderr, exit_code)
char *stdout_start = strstr(response, "\"stdout\":\"");
char *stderr_start = strstr(response, "\"stderr\":\"");
char *exit_code_start = strstr(response, "\"exit_code\":");
int exit_code = 1;
if (exit_code_start) {
exit_code = atoi(exit_code_start + 12);
}
// Print stdout
if (stdout_start) {
stdout_start += 10;
printf("%s", BLUE);
for (char *p = stdout_start; *p && !(*p == '"' && *(p-1) != '\\'); p++) {
if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== 'n') {
putchar('\n');
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== 't') {
putchar('\t');
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== '"') {
putchar('"');
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== '\\') {
putchar('\\');
p++;
} else {
putchar(*p);
}
}
printf("%s", RESET);
}
// Print stderr
if (stderr_start) {
stderr_start += 10;
fprintf(stderr, "%s", RED);
for (char *p = stderr_start; *p && !(*p == '"' && *(p-1) != '\\'); p++) {
if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== 'n') {
fputc('\n', stderr);
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== 't') {
fputc('\t', stderr);
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== '"') {
fputc('"', stderr);
p++;
} else if (*p == '\\' && *(p+1) == '\\') {
fputc('\\', stderr);
p++;
} else {
fputc(*p, stderr);
}
}
fprintf(stderr, "%s", RESET);
}
free(code);
free(json_body);
exit(exit_code);
}
void cmd_session(int list, const char *kill, const char *shell, const char *network, int vcpu, int tmux, int screen, const char *api_key) {
char cmd[4096];
if (list)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X GET '%s/sessions'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("\n");
return;
}
if (kill)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X DELETE '%s/sessions/%s'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, kill,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("%sSession terminated: %s%s\n", GREEN, kill, RESET);
return;
}
// Create session
char json[1024];
snprintf(json, sizeof(json), "{\"shell\":\"%s\"", shell ? shell : "bash");
if (network) {
char temp[128];
snprintf(temp, sizeof(temp), ",\"network\":\"%s\"", network);
strcat(json, temp);
}
if (vcpu > 0) {
char temp[64];
snprintf(temp, sizeof(temp), ",\"vcpu\":%d", vcpu);
strcat(json, temp);
}
if (tmux) {
strcat(json, ",\"persistence\":\"tmux\"");
}
if (screen) {
strcat(json, ",\"persistence\":\"screen\"");
}
strcat(json, "}");
printf("%sCreating session...%s\n", YELLOW, RESET);
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X POST '%s/sessions' -H 'Content-Type: application/json' "
"-H 'Authorization: Bearer %s' -d '%s'",
API_BASE, api_key, json);
system(cmd);
printf("\n%sSession created%s\n", GREEN, RESET);
}
void cmd_service(const char *name, const char *ports, const char *domains, const char *service_type, const char *bootstrap, int list, const char *info, const char *logs, const char *tail, const char *sleep_svc, const char *wake, const char *destroy, const char *network, int vcpu, const char *api_key) {
char cmd[8192];
if (list)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X GET '%s/services'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("\n");
return;
}
if (info)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X GET '%s/services/%s'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, info,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("\n");
return;
}
if (logs)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X GET '%s/services/%s/logs'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, logs, api_key);
system(cmd);
return;
}
if (tail)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X GET '%s/services/%s/logs?lines=9000'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, tail, api_key);
system(cmd);
return;
}
if (sleep_svc)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X POST '%s/services/%s/sleep'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, sleep_svc,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("%sService sleeping: %s%s\n", GREEN, sleep_svc, RESET);
return;
}
if (wake)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X POST '%s/services/%s/wake'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, wake,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("%sService waking: %s%s\n", GREEN, wake, RESET);
return;
}
if (destroy) {
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X DELETE '%s/services/%s' -H 'Authorization: Bearer %s'",
API_BASE, destroy, api_key);
system(cmd);
printf("%sService destroyed: %s%s\n", GREEN, destroy, RESET);
return;
}
if (name) {
char json[4096];
snprintf(json, sizeof(json), "{\"name\":\"%s\"", name);
if (ports) {
char temp[256];
snprintf(temp, sizeof(temp), ",\"ports\":[%s]", ports);
strcat(json, temp);
}
if (service_type) {
char temp[128];
snprintf(temp, sizeof(temp), ",\"service_type\":\"%s\"", service_type);
strcat(json, temp);
}
if (bootstrap) {
// Check if file
struct stat st;
if (stat(bootstrap, &st) == 0) {
char *boot_code = read_file(bootstrap);
if (boot_code) {
strcat(json, ",\"bootstrap\":\"");
for (char *p = boot_code; *p; p++) {
// Simplified escaping
if (*p == '"') strcat(json, "\\\"");
else if (*p == '\n') strcat(json, "\\n");
else { char c[2] = {*p, 0}; strcat(json, c); }
}
strcat(json, "\"");
free(boot_code);
}
} else {
strcat(json, ",\"bootstrap\":\"");
strcat(json, bootstrap);
strcat(json, "\"");
}
}
strcat(json, "}");
printf("%sCreating service...%s\n", YELLOW, RESET);
snprintf(cmd, sizeof(cmd),
"curl -s -X POST '%s/services' -H 'Content-Type: application/json' "
"-H 'Authorization: Bearer %s' -d '%s'",
API_BASE, api_key, json);
system(cmd);
printf("\n%sService created%s\n", GREEN, RESET);
return;
}
fprintf(stderr, "%sError: Specify --name to create a service%s\n", RED, RESET);
exit(1);
}
int main(int argc, char *argv[]) {
const char *api_key = getenv("UNSANDBOX_API_KEY");
if (!api_key && argc > 1 && strcmp(argv[1], "session") != 0 && strcmp(argv[1], "service") != 0) {
fprintf(stderr, "%sError: UNSANDBOX_API_KEY not set%s\n", RED, RESET);
return 1;
}
if (argc < 2) {
fprintf(stderr, "Usage: %s [options] <source_file>\n", argv[0]);
fprintf(stderr, " %s session [options]\n", argv[0]);
fprintf(stderr, " %s service [options]\n", argv[0]);
return 1;
}
// Parse command
if (strcmp(argv[1], "session") == 0) {
int list = 0;
const char *kill = NULL;
const char *shell = NULL;
const char *network = NULL;
int vcpu = 0;
int tmux = 0;
int screen = 0;
for (int i = 2; i < argc; i++) {
if (strcmp(argv[i], "--list") == 0) list = 1;
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--kill")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) kill =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--shell")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) shell =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-n")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) network =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-v")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) vcpu = atoi(argv[++i]);
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--tmux") == 0) tmux = 1;
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--screen") == 0) screen = 1;
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-k")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) api_key = argv[++i];
}
cmd_session(list, kill, shell, network, vcpu, tmux, screen, api_key);
return 0;
}
if (strcmp(argv[1], "service") == 0) {
const char *name = NULL;
const char *ports = NULL;
const char *domains = NULL;
const char *service_type = NULL;
const char *bootstrap = NULL;
int list = 0;
const char *info = NULL;
const char *logs = NULL;
const char *tail = NULL;
const char *sleep_svc = NULL;
const char *wake = NULL;
const char *destroy = NULL;
const char *network = NULL;
int vcpu = 0;
for (int i = 2; i < argc; i++) {
if (strcmp(argv[i], "--name")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) name =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--ports")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) ports =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--domains")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) domains =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--type")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) service_type =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--bootstrap")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) bootstrap =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--list") == 0) list = 1;
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--info")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) info =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--logs")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) logs =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--tail")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) tail =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--sleep")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) sleep_svc =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--wake")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) wake =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"--destroy")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) destroy =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-n")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) network = argv[++i];
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-v")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) vcpu = atoi(argv[++i]);
else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-k")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) api_key = argv[++i];
}
cmd_service(name, ports, domains, service_type, bootstrap, list, info, logs, tail, sleep_svc, wake, destroy, network, vcpu, api_key);
return 0;
}
// Execute mode
char *envs[32];
int env_count = 0;
char *files[32];
int file_count = 0;
int artifacts = 0;
const char *output_dir = NULL;
const char *network = NULL;
int vcpu = 0;
const char *source_file = NULL;
for (int i = 1; i < argc; i++) {
if (strcmp(argv[i], "-e")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
envs[env_count++] = argv[++i];
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-f")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
files[file_count++] = argv[++i];
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-a") == 0) {
artifacts = 1;
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-o")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
output_dir = argv[++i];
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-n")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
network = argv[++i];
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-v")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
vcpu = atoi(argv[++i]);
} else if (strcmp(argv[i], "-k") == 0 && i + 1 < argc) {
api_key = argv[++i];
} else if (!source_file && argv[i][0] != '-') {
source_file = argv[i];
}
}
if (!source_file) {
fprintf(stderr, "%sError: No source file specified%s\n", RED, RESET);
return 1;
}
cmd_execute(source_file, envs, env_count, files, file_count, artifacts, output_dir, network, vcpu, api_key);
return 0;
}
